Introducing the CDK Drive Repair Order App Programming Interface (API), designed specifically for Fortellis. This newly created API gives contracted third-party software vendors the ability to safely and securely open and edit service repair orders within CDK Drive.

With Repair Order API, dealers can now do the following:

  • Manage repair orders within any participating app, increasing service department efficiency
  • Improve end-user experiences through faster data access and lower latency
  • Increase customer choices with an ecosystem of apps for managing repair orders

The Repair Order API gives dealerships and software developers access to the full lifecycle of a repair order, including creating a repair order record, adding services, and the creation and approval of additional service requests.

Included in this new API is a complete repair order workflow orchestration of five supporting APIs, available for the first time through Fortellis:

Service Vehicles API
OpCodes API
Service Customer API
Vehicle Specifications API
Repair Order API

Scaling efficiency in the Service lane

Both Xtime, a scheduling and processing service solution from Cox Automotive, and GoMoto, a kiosk that offers an enhanced service check-in experience, have beta tested and are now using the CDK Repair Order API through Fortellis to expand the capabilities of existing service-related apps.

Mobile scheduling and service updates with Xtime

Xtime Inspect and Engage products provide dealers with the ability to offer mobile scheduling, check-in, and service updates to customers.

The integration between the Repair Order API and Xtime gives Service Advisors and Technicians the one-stop solution they need to resolve repair orders, driving a more efficient experience for both dealerships and customers.

Self-service vehicle check-in by GoMoto

GoMoto uses the Repair Order API to power self-serve vehicle check-in kiosks with more useful features to drive Service profitability. The enhanced check-in solution uses the Fortellis API connection to give flexibility to Service Advisors and time back to customers.
